pg_backup_db.c contained a mini SQL lexer with which it tried to identify
boundaries between SQL commands, but that code was not designed to cope
with standard_conforming_strings, and would get the wrong answer if a
backslash immediately precedes a closing single quote in such a string,
as per report from Julian Mehnle. The bug only affects direct-to-database
restores from archive files made with standard_conforming_strings = on.
Rather than complicating the code some more to try to fix that, let's just
rip it all out. The only reason it was needed was to cope with COPY data
embedded into ordinary archive entries, which was a layout that was used
only for about the first three weeks of the archive format's existence,
and never in any production release of pg_dump. Instead, just rely on the
archive file layout to tell us whether we're printing COPY data or not.
This bug represents a data corruption hazard in all releases in which
standard_conforming_strings can be turned on, ie 8.2 and later, so
back-patch to all supported branches.

Certain subdirectories do not get built if corresponding options are not
selected at configure time. However, "make distprep" should visit such
directories anyway, so that constructing derived files to be included in
the tarball happens without requiring all configure options to be given
in the tarball build script. Likewise, it's better if cleanup actions
unconditionally visit all directories (for example, this ensures proper
cleanup if someone has done a manual make in such a subdirectory).
To handle this, set up a convention that subdirectories that are
conditionally included in SUBDIRS should be added to ALWAYS_SUBDIRS
instead when they are excluded.
Back-patch to 9.1, so that plpython's spiexceptions.h will get provided
in 9.1 tarballs. There don't appear to be any instances where distprep
actions got missed in previous releases, and anyway this fix requires
gmake 3.80 so we don't want to apply it before 9.1.

Add a postmaster_is_alive() test to the wait loop, so that we stop waiting
if the postmaster dies without removing its pidfile. Unfortunately this
only helps after the postmaster has created its pidfile, since until then
we don't know which PID to check. But if it never does create the pidfile,
we can give up in a relatively short time, so this is a useful addition
in practice. Per suggestion from Fujii Masao, though this doesn't look
very much like his patch.
In addition, improve pg_ctl's ability to cope with pre-existing pidfiles.
Such a file might or might not represent a live postmaster that is going to
block our postmaster from starting, but the previous code pre-judged the
situation and gave up waiting immediately. Now, we will wait for up to 5
seconds to see if our postmaster overwrites such a file. This issue
interacts with Fujii's patch because we would make the wrong conclusion
if we did the postmaster_is_alive() test with a pre-existing PID.
All of this could be improved if we rewrote start_postmaster() so that it
could report the child postmaster's PID, so that we'd know a-priori the
correct PID to test with postmaster_is_alive(). That looks like a bit too
much change for so late in the 9.1 development cycle, unfortunately.

pg_dump has some heuristic rules for whether to dump casts and procedural
languages, since it's not all that easy to distinguish built-in ones from
user-defined ones. However, we should not apply those rules to objects
that belong to an extension, but just use the perfectly well-defined rules
for what to do with extension member objects. Otherwise we might
mistakenly lose extension member objects during a binary upgrade (which is
the only time that we'd want to dump extension members).
